Company Overview
History and Background
D.R. Horton, Inc. was founded in 1978 by Donald R. Horton. It began as a local homebuilder in Fort Worth, Texas, and has grown to become the largest homebuilder by volume in the United States. The company has expanded geographically and diversified its offerings through acquisitions and internal growth.
Core Business Areas
- Homebuilding: This segment is the core of DR Horton's business, involving the construction and sale of single-family homes under various brands catering to different price points and buyer preferences (entry-level, move-up, active adult, and luxury). Includes land acquisition, development, and construction.
- Financial Services: This segment provides mortgage financing and title services to DR Horton's homebuyers. This improves the home buying process, enhances profitability and reduces time to sale.
- Rental: DR Horton develops and manages rental properties.
Leadership and Structure
David V. Auld serves as the Chairman of the Board. Paul J. Romanowski is President and CEO. The company has a hierarchical organizational structure with regional and divisional management teams overseeing operations in various geographic areas. Board of directors provides oversight and governance.
Top Products and Market Share
Key Offerings
- Entry-Level Homes (Express Homes): Entry-level homes are targeted at first-time homebuyers. They represent a significant portion of DR Horton's sales volume. Competitors include Lennar, PulteGroup, and NVR. Market share for individual brands is not publicly broken out, but D.R. Horton as a whole is the market leader.
- Move-Up Homes (D.R. Horton Homes): Move-up homes are designed for buyers looking for larger homes or additional features. These homes command higher average selling prices. Competitors include Toll Brothers and smaller regional builders.
- Active Adult Homes (Freedom Homes): Active adult homes target buyers aged 55+. These communities often feature amenities tailored to this demographic. Competitors include PulteGroup (Del Webb) and Lennar (Villas).
- Luxury Homes (Emerald Homes): DR Horton offers luxury homes, Emerald Homes, which features additional amenities and high-end finishes
Market Dynamics
Industry Overview
The homebuilding industry is cyclical and highly sensitive to economic conditions, interest rates, and consumer confidence. Currently, it is dealing with high mortgage rates and high inflation that are impacting consumer spending and affordability. Long-term, demand remains supported by demographic trends.
Positioning
DR Horton is the largest homebuilder in the US by volume. Its competitive advantages include its scale, efficient operations, strong brand recognition, geographic diversity, and focus on entry-level housing. This positioning allows it to capture a large share of the market and achieve economies of scale.

Major Acquisitions
Vidler Water Resources Inc.
- Year: 2021
- Acquisition Price (USD millions): 373
- Strategic Rationale: Acquired Vidler Water Resources Inc. to secure water rights and resources, crucial for sustainable growth in water-scarce regions. This is a bet on long term growth.

About DR Horton Inc
Exchange NYSE | Headquaters Arlington, TX, United States | ||
IPO Launch date 1992-06-05 | President, CEO & Director Mr. Paul J. Romanowski | ||
Sector Consumer Cyclical | Industry Residential Construction | Full time employees 14766 | Website https://www.drhorton.com |
Full time employees 14766 | Website https://www.drhorton.com |
D.R. Horton, Inc. operates as a homebuilding company in East, North, Southeast, South Central, Southwest, and Northwest regions in the United States. It engages in the acquisition and development of land; and construction and sale of residential homes in 125 markets across 36 states under the names of D.R. Horton. The company constructs and sells single-family detached homes; and attached homes, such as townhomes, duplexes, and triplexes. It provides mortgage financing services; and title insurance policies, and examination and closing services, as well as engages in the residential lot development business. In addition, the company develops, constructs, owns, leases, and sells multi-family and single-family rental properties; and owns non-residential real estate, including ranch land and improvements. It primarily serves homebuyers. D.R. Horton, Inc. was founded in 1978 and is headquartered in Arlington, Texas.
